It's heavily tied to the concept of testimony. The healed character almost always gives a verbal account of their journey, either privately to the love interest or publicly before their church. This act of vocalizing the healing solidifies it and serves as a ministry to others. The novels posit that your brokenness has a purpose—to later comfort others. This turns the personal healing into a missional one. The romance often blossoms in the safe space created when one character shares their testimony first, inviting the other to be vulnerable in return.

The animal symbolism! A wounded bird being nursed back to flight, a stubborn horse learning to trust, a lost dog finding home—these subplots aren't just cute filler. They are direct, simplistic metaphors for the protagonist's own spiritual healing process. The character often sees their own situation reflected in the animal's journey, which helps them understand their own path. Caring for a vulnerable creature also opens their heart to receiving care. It's a heavy-handed but effective narrative device for a genre that thrives on clear, emotive symbolism.

A key component is the renunciation of self-reliance. The pivotal healing moment is when the 'strong' character who has been trying to handle everything alone finally breaks down and asks for help—from God and from the community (including the love interest). This humility is framed as the beginning of true strength. The novels depict spiritual healing as the opposite of pulling yourself up by your bootstraps; it's about admitting you have no boots and accepting the gift of shoes. The romantic relationship models this interdependence beautifully.

Hmm, not my usual genre, but my book club did one last month. The spiritual healing part felt very... prescriptive? Like, the steps were clear: admit brokenness, seek guidance, read the Bible, forgive, accept love. It was less about a mysterious, personal spiritual experience and more about checking boxes aligned with evangelical Protestant teachings. The healing was confirmed through a return to church attendance and a vocal testimony. It made me wonder if that resonates because it offers a clear, hopeful roadmap, or if it oversimplifies the chaotic reality of grief and faith.

The act of creation becomes a pathway. A character who heals by gardening (bringing life from dirt), painting, writing, or restoring an old house is engaging in a sub-creative act that mirrors God's restorative work. As they bring order and beauty to something broken, they participate in their own healing. The love interest may join in or provide the space and resources for this creation. This moves spirituality out of the intellectual realm and into the hands, making healing active, tangible, and satisfying. It argues that we are co-creators with God in the restoration of our own souls.

The use of time is huge. Healing isn't rushed to fit the pacing of a meet-cute. The best books use timeskips effectively, showing the character in a stable relationship but still dealing with triggers or bad days years later. The 'happy ever after' includes the understanding that some scars remain, but they don't define the joy of the present. That long-term view makes the emotional resolution more believable.

As a practical moral compass in ethically gray situations. The plot might involve a business dilemma, a family secret, or a legal dispute. The characters' faith directly informs their choices, often at great personal cost. It's portrayed as the thing that keeps them honest when cheating would be easier. The romance blooms in the soil of that shared integrity. You see the faith in action, not just in sentiment. The love interest falls for the protagonist because of their stubborn, faith-driven principles, not in spite of them. It makes the love feel earned and deeply respectful.

Burnout and recovery is a critical modern arc. A pastor or dedicated volunteer collapses under the weight of performance and expectation. Their spiritual growth happens in the forced stillness of recovery. They learn to separate their identity from their productivity, to receive instead of always give, and to find God in rest. It's a powerful correction to the 'doing for God' mentality and a journey toward a faith rooted in 'being with God.' This resonates deeply in our achievement-oriented culture.
